Understanding Steak Doneness Levels

When it comes to cooking steak, understanding the different levels of doneness is crucial for achieving your desired result. Each level of doneness corresponds to a specific steak internal temp range:

  • Blue Rare: 115°F - 120°F (46°C - 49°C)
    • Very red center
    • Soft texture
    • Minimal cooking time
  • Rare: 120°F - 125°F (49°C - 52°C)
    • Bright red center
    • Warm throughout
    • Soft and tender
  • Medium Rare: 130°F - 135°F (54°C - 57°C)
    • Warm red center
    • Most popular choice
    • Perfect balance of tenderness and flavor
  • Medium: 140°F - 145°F (60°C - 63°C)
    • Pink center
    • Firm texture
    • Less juicy than medium rare
  • Medium Well: 150°F - 155°F (66°C - 68°C)
    • Slightly pink center
    • Firm throughout
    • Less tender
  • Well Done: 160°F+ (71°C+)
    • No pink remaining
    • Firm and chewy
    • Least juicy option

The Science Behind Steak Internal Temperature

Understanding the science behind steak internal temp is essential for achieving perfect results. When you cook steak, several important processes occur:

  • Protein Denaturation: As temperature increases, muscle fibers contract and proteins denature, affecting texture and moisture.
  • Moisture Retention: Different temperatures affect how much moisture is retained in the meat.
  • Flavor Development: The Maillard reaction occurs between 300°F-500°F (150°C-260°C), creating complex flavors.
  • Collagen Breakdown: Connective tissues break down into gelatin, especially important for tougher cuts.

How to Measure Steak Internal Temp Accurately

Accurate temperature measurement is crucial for perfect steak doneness. Follow these expert tips:

Types of Meat Thermometers

  • Instant-Read Thermometers: Provide quick temperature readings
  • Leave-In Thermometers: Monitor temperature throughout cooking
  • Wireless Thermometers: Allow remote monitoring

Proper Thermometer Technique

  1. Insert thermometer into the thickest part of the steak
  2. Avoid touching bone or fat
  3. Wait for stable reading
  4. Account for carryover cooking (temperature continues to rise after removing from heat)

Best Cooking Techniques for Perfect Steak

Pan-Searing Method

The pan-searing method is ideal for achieving a perfect crust while maintaining proper steak internal temp:

  1. Preheat heavy skillet over medium-high heat
  2. Pat steak dry and season generously
  3. Sear each side for 2-3 minutes
  4. Use thermometer to check internal temp
  5. Finish in oven if necessary

Grilling Techniques

Grilling offers unique flavor and texture advantages:

  • Preheat grill to high heat
  • Use two-zone cooking method
  • Sear over direct heat
  • Move to indirect heat to finish cooking
  • Monitor internal temperature closely

The Importance of Resting Your Steak

Resting your steak after cooking is crucial for optimal results:

  • Allows juices to redistribute throughout the meat
  • Prevents juices from running out when cut
  • Typical resting time: 5-10 minutes
  • Internal temperature will continue to rise 5-10°F during resting

Food Safety Considerations

When cooking steak, food safety is paramount:

  • Minimum safe internal temperature: 145°F (63°C)
  • Use separate cutting boards for raw and cooked meat
  • Wash hands and surfaces thoroughly
  • Store raw meat properly at 40°F (4°C) or below
  • Source: USDA Food Safety Guidelines

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Many home cooks make these common mistakes when cooking steak:

  • Not preheating cooking surface properly
  • Overcrowding the pan or grill
  • Not using a thermometer
  • Flipping steak too frequently
  • Cutting into steak to check doneness

Professional Chef's Secrets

Professional chefs share these expert tips for perfect steak:

  1. Season steak at least 40 minutes before cooking
  2. Use high-quality, fresh ingredients
  3. Let steak come to room temperature before cooking
  4. Use butter and herbs for basting
  5. Invest in proper equipment
